Understanding ADC specs and architectures: part 3
Integral nonlinearity tracks the cumulative effects of an ADC’s differential nonlinearity. In part 2 of this series, we discussed several sources of error in an analog-to-digital converter (ADC), including gain, offset, missing-code error, and differential nonlinearity (DNL). We concluded with an illustration of a waveform with varying levels of DNL superimposed on the staircase representing...

Understanding ADC specs and architectures: part 4
The AC performance of an analog-to-digital converter depends on its architecture. In part 3 of this series, we discussed the integral nonlinearity (INL) error of an analog-to-digital converter (ADC), noting that gain, offset, and INL error all contribute to the total unadjusted error. This metric provides an overall view of an ADC’s DC performance.
